Question 1 of 10 Read this excerpt from the dissenting opinion in a Supreme Court case. If a white man and a black man choose to occupy the same public conveyance on a public highway, it is their right to do so , and no government,proceeding alone on grounds of race, can prevent it without infringing the personal liberty of each. I Which case is the excerpt most likely from? A. Bolling v. Sharpe B. Plessy v. Ferguson C. Hernandez v. Texas D. Brown v. Board of Education

The excerpt is most likely from the dissenting opinion in the case of Plessy v. Ferguson. This case dealt with racial segregation laws for public facilities under the doctrine of "separate but equal." The dissenting opinion, written by Justice John Marshall Harlan, argued against the constitutionality of racial segregation and emphasized personal liberty regardless of race.
